MONEY TREE
Kids Coin Learning Game

The expression "Money doesnt grow on trees" has always sparked kids imaginations. They may imagine planting a penny in the ground and waking up the next day to a huge tree full of money or a field of trees full of money just waiting for them to fill their pockets.

In this game the money tree is a cute and friendly looking tree that drops coins for kids to catch in a barrel. The barrel is piloted by one of 6 fun characters. Kids will have fun and learn to recognize the different coins and their values.

Basic Instructions:
 
-Catch the coins in your barrel. That change really adds up quick!
 
-Position the barrel under the coins by tilting right or left in the direction you want to move.
 
-If you miss 5 coins in a row, then you lose your barrel except in a bonus level (every third level).  In a bonus level ( levels 3, 6, 9, … ) you can’t lose your barrel; just catch as many coins as you can.
 
-If you catch a barrel, you will have an extra wide barrel to catch the coins for the rest of the round.
 
-Extra barrels are awarded at $10, $50 and at each additional $50
